Galen vs Galin

American parents have registered 17,060 Galens since 1880, against 18 Galins. Galen is still ahead, with 23 babies in 2025.

Who was ahead

Galen has been the commoner name in every year either was published, 1889 to 2025. The lead has never changed hands.

The closest they came was 1994, when Galen had 166 and Galin had 6.

Which name is older

Half of the Galins alive today are over 68; half the Galens are over 52. That is 16 years between them: two names in use at the same time, worn by two different generations.
